当前位置: 首页 > news >正文

如何编写一个网站平台网站应该怎样做seo

如何编写一个网站,平台网站应该怎样做seo,算命网站开发电话,下载手机最新版app目录 一、创建 vue3 项目 vite-vue3-project-js二、创建项目目录三、创建Home、About组件以及 vue-router 配置路由四、修改完成后页面 一、创建 vue3 项目 vite-vue3-project-js 使用 vite 创建一个极简 vue3 项目请参考此文章:使用Vite创建一个vue3项目 下面是我…

目录

  • 一、创建 vue3 项目 vite-vue3-project-js
  • 二、创建项目目录
  • 三、创建Home、About组件以及 vue-router 配置路由
  • 四、修改完成后页面

一、创建 vue3 项目 vite-vue3-project-js

使用 vite 创建一个极简 vue3 项目请参考此文章:使用Vite创建一个vue3项目

下面是我在创建vue3项目时,没有切换 node 版本导致的node版本兼容性警告。 vite3 需要 node 必须是 =18 || >=20 版本才行。

在这里插入图片描述

分享一个 node 版本管理器 nvm(点击进入下载页面 github),可以很方便的切换 node 版本,大家可以安装一个试试。
如果使用 nvm 安装 node 失败的话可以参考这篇文章解决问题:使用nvm安装nodejs时,npm安装失败,提示 handshake timeout 。

下载 nvm 时,选择 nvm-setup.exe 安装程序安装。
在这里插入图片描述

二、创建项目目录

根据目录文件,在新建的 vite-vue3-project-js 项目的 src 目录文件夹下创建目录文件:

├── src
│   ├── api            		数据请求
│   ├── assets         		静态资源
│		├── images    	 	图片
│		├── style      		样式
│   ├── components     		公共组件
│   ├── layout         		布局(自定义菜单与内容布局)
│   ├── pages          		页面组件
│		├── Home       		
│		├── About      		
│   ├── router         		路由配置
│   ├── stores          	数据状态管理
│   └── utils          		工具函数
│		├── request.js 		axios封装

三、创建Home、About组件以及 vue-router 配置路由

  1. 安装 vue-router。

    npm install vue-router@next
    
  2. 使用 createRouter 创建 router 路由,在 router 文件夹中新建 index.js,书写如下代码:

    import { createRouter, createWebHistory } from "vue-router";
    import Home from "../pages/Home/index.vue"
    const routes = [{path: '/',name: 'home',component: Home,},{path: '/about',name: 'about',component: () => import('../pages/About/index.vue')}
    ]
    const router = createRouter({history: createWebHistory(import.meta.env.BASE_URL),routes,
    })
    export default router;
    
  3. 创建Home、About组件。

    <!-- src/Home/index.vue -->
    <template><div><h3>This is Home page</h3><HelloWorld msg="Vite + Vue" /></div>
    </template><script setup>
    import HelloWorld from '../../components/HelloWorld.vue'
    </script><style lang="scss" scoped></style>
    
    <!-- src/About/index.vue -->
    <template><div><h3>This is About page!</h3></div>
    </template><script setup></script><style lang="scss" scoped></style>
    
  4. 修改App.vue文件。

    <template><h1>Hello App!</h1><div><a href="https://vitejs.dev" target="_blank"><img src="/vite.svg" class="logo" alt="Vite logo" /></a><a href="https://vuejs.org/" target="_blank"><img src="./assets/vue.svg" class="logo vue" alt="Vue logo" /></a></div><p><!-- 使用 router-link 组件进行导航 --><!-- 通过传递 `to` 来指定链接 --><!-- `<router-link>` 将呈现一个带有正确 `href` 属性的 `<a>` 标签 --><nav><router-link to="/">Home</router-link> |<router-link to="/about">About</router-link></nav></p><hr><!-- 路由出口 --><!-- 路由匹配到的组件将渲染在这里 --><router-view></router-view>
    </template>
    

    <style scoped></style>中添加 nav、router-link 的样式

    nav {width: 100%;text-align: center;margin-top: 2rem;
    }
    nav a.router-link-exact-active {color: var(--color-text);
    }
    nav a.router-link-exact-active:hover {background-color: transparent;
    }
    nav a {display: inline-block;padding: 0 1rem;border-left: 1px solid var(--color-border);
    }
    nav a:first-of-type {border: 0;
    }
    
  5. 将 style.css 中的样式注释。

    body {margin: 0;/* display: flex;place-items: center; */min-width: 320px;min-height: 100vh;
    }
    
  6. 修改 main.js 文件,挂载 router 路由。

    import { createApp } from 'vue'
    import './style.css'
    import App from './App.vue'
    import router from "./router/index.js"const app = createApp(App)
    app.use(router)// 挂载永远是最后一步
    app.mount('#app')
    

四、修改完成后页面

在这里插入图片描述

http://www.yayakq.cn/news/257476/

相关文章:

  • 装饰网站建设效果图做微商怎么找客源加人
  • 中国建设银行网站会员可以改名现在的网站开发框架
  • 中小学 网站建设 通知炎陵网站建设
  • 在线做网页的网站seo综合查询爱站
  • 网站怎么做按钮外汇网站建设公司
  • 合肥花境建设网站手机网站生成
  • 有专业做外贸的网站吗深圳市网站备案
  • 制作网站需要钱吗wordpress设置网址
  • 呼和浩特做网站的公司wordpress heroku
  • 明星网站怎么设计南宁购物网站建设
  • 网站关键词推广做自然排名做哪些网站比较赚钱方法
  • 做捕鱼网站电话号码苏州做网站知识的分享
  • 郑州网站建设hnqfu运营电商是做什么的
  • 网站开发地址做问卷兼职有哪些网站
  • 高端建设网站建设网站站长工具
  • 淘宝客的网站怎么做呢人工智能培训心得体会
  • 重庆网站设计总部手机微信营销软件
  • 苏州网站建设点一点沙河网站建设
  • 做折页的网站wordpress 数据库 插件
  • 科普网站栏目建设方案网易云wordpress
  • 天津大良网站建设注册个体可以做网站吗
  • 行业门户网站建设费用莱芜金点子信息港官网
  • 做好网站如何发布淘宝客如何建设自己的网站
  • 一流的高密做网站的上海设计网站大全
  • 网站建设cms百度推广必须做手机网站吗
  • 地方门户网站用户小程序怎么开发自己的微信小程序
  • 不会编程能建网站资阳市住房和城乡建设局网站
  • 如何选择镇江网站优化建设工程信息网官网新网站
  • 上海专业网站建设流程慧聪网的网站建设策略
  • 用织梦做的学校网站切换国外ip的软件